It is easy to locate uPVC replacement door handles. They have the same dimensions as the original ones, repairmywindowsanddoors with the exception of for the top screw. Most commonly, these handles are around 92mm, with a difference in PZ (the distance between the middle of the handle and the keyhole). The PZ is a key aspect to be considered when buying replacement handles, however the overall length is not as significant. The new handles should be able to fit inside the keyhole, without creating gaps.

There are two main kinds of uPVC door handles that can be replaced such as paddle and lever. The lever is situated on the inside of your door and the paddle on the outside. In this case the lever locks automatically when the door is shut. To open the door from the outside, you'll have to insert the key. The paddle and lever are universally handed and come in a variety of styles to meet different tastes and requirements.
This adjustable flexi-uPVC handle can be used to replace various kinds of door handles. The adjustable PZ can be adjusted to accommodate different door handles. It also covers the screw holes that are already in place. To ensure that it functions properly make sure you measure the ZL and PZ. This is the distance between the key hole and the centre of the handle lever/spindle hole. These measurements are usually 92mm in PZ.
You'll need to determine the dimensions of door handles made of upvc. First, measure the screw holes and keyholes. Some locations require very little clearance through the lockcase. You may have to drill again. Then, you need to measure the length of the spindle as well as the centre of the screw that is on top. Thirdly, you must measure the length of your lever.

It is simple and inexpensive to replace the door handle. First, you must remove the screws from the old handle. As long that the handle isn't fixed at the back, it will be easy to remove. The screws on the opposite side of the door have to be removed. Most UPVC door handles feature two screws. The screws are typically hidden behind caps or a face plate.
